Whitby, Scarborough and Bridlington's rugby sides are all on their travels on Saturday.
Scarborough are looking to make it five wins on the bounce when they make the short trip to Malton & Norton in North One East.
Matty Jones' men have been in formidable form and beat league leaders Ilkley, last week.
Bridlington go to Roundhegians in Yorkshire One hoping to make it back to back wins.
Whitby go to County Durham in Durham & Northumberland Division Two.
Sedgefield provide the opposition.
